The Claim
In resistance-trained female collegiate athletes, the consumption of 24 grams of whey protein or casein protein immediately before and after resistance training sessions over an eight-week period results in no significant differences in changes in body composition, muscle strength, or anaerobic performance, suggesting equivalent effectiveness of both protein types when consumed in equal per-dose amounts around training.
